Table 2.

Results of Incidence Density (ID) and Logistic Regression Analysis of Baseline Caries Risk Factors Relationship to d2-3f Caries after 18 months (n = 128)

Baseline Factor Incidence Density (ID) Analysis Odds Ratio (95% CI) from Logistic Regression Analysis
ID/ month IDR* p-value
Presence of Plaque Yes (n=39) 0.017 2.41 0.015 3.4 (1.4, 8.4)
No (n=86) 0.007
Presence of MS Yes (n=17) 0.026 5.55 <0.001 7.4 (2.6, 21.3)
No (n=106) 0.005
Sugar-Sweetened Beverage Consumption Yes (n=44) 0.019 3.44 0.001 5.2 (2.0, 13.3)
No (n =81) 0.006
Night time bottle Feeding Yes (n = 73) 0.008 0.55 0.062 0.4 (0.2, 1.03)
No (n = 52) 0.014
*

IDR = Incidence Density Ratio

Sugar Sweetened Beverages included regular soda pop, sugared beverages made from powder, sports drinks, juice drinks and other sugared beverages
